The urgency for the world to come together and tackle global challenges has never been greater. In response, the United Nations is stepping up its response and is moving toward its UN 2.0 Quintet of Change, the roadmap defined by the UN Secretary-General to foster innovation, drive reform and deliver effective results to address the challenges of the 21st century. Through the Quintet of Change, a new world of opportunities has opened up for adaptable and effective leaders in international development.
Hone your expertise with immediately actionable knowledge to drive positive change in our increasingly globalized world. With our transformative executive program—designed specifically around the UN 2.0 Quintet of Change—you will learn to confidently take on the challenges of the 2030 Agenda for Sustainable Development. The Executive Master in International Development is designed for leaders who are eager to promote sustainable social, economic and environmental prosperity around the world.
Take the opportunity to boost your career, pivot your existing experience, align your skill set with the future to maximize the global impact of your actions and position yourself at the top of the development system.
